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
759963 3205600837 6217 14407426282
04492049745 099054574 226
04492049745 099054574 226
827 89588 605307361 6044 7854
All about undefined
Interested in learning more?
04492049745 099054574 226
827 89588 605307361 6044 7854
See more
68401 47 9715
80187 74753 01920878 53
See more
76104 6986 3842
26931 9619550 425839315 568482
See more